How Escape Games Actually Work
At their core, Escape Games are immersive challenges where players gather clues, collaborate, and decode puzzles to “escape” a set environment within a time limit. Designed with narrative arcs, they balance logic, observation, and creativity. Participants move through mission rooms or virtual environments, solving riddles, manipulating objects, and communicating effectively. Most maintain clear objectives and intuitive rules, ensuring accessibility regardless of prior experience. The experience combines critical thinking with teamwork, making it both mentally engaging and socially rewarding.

How long does an Escape Game last?
Typically 60 to 90 minutes, though variations exist—some rooms offer shorter sessions or longer themed experiences.
Do I need prior experience to play?
No. Most venues design games with layered difficulty, welcoming beginners, families, and experts alike.
Can I play Escape Games alone?
Many venues offer solo challenges or split-based group play; digital Escape Games enable remote, timed solos.
Are they suitable for teams or social groups?
Yes. Escape Games thrive on collaboration—teams of up to six or more enjoy synchronized problem-solving, fostering communication and bonding.
What themes do escape rooms explore?
From historical mysteries and futuristic tech to zombie-infested labs and spy missions, themes blend genre creativity with narrative depth.
